Date Set for New Round of Iran-US Talks

TEHRAN (Tasnim) – The timing of the next round of nuclear talks between Iran and the US has been determined,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araqchi said.

Speaking to reporters on the sidelines of Tehran Dialogue Forum on Sunday, Araqchi said the date of the next round of talks with the US has been determined and will be announced soon.

The next round of negotiations will probably be held soon, he added, saying the time and location of the talks will be made public later.

Asked if Oman has relayed any message from the US to Iran, the foreign minister said, “We have not received any written message from Oman.”

Iran and the US have held four rounds of talks since April 12, mediated by Oman, with the purpose of reaching a deal on Iran’s nuclear program and the removal of sanctions on Tehran.
